@charset "UTF-8";
/* CSS Document */

.content_main_contact {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 600px;
}
.content_main_toku {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 1500px;
}
.content_main_index {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 450px;
}
.content_main {
	width: 1050px;
	background-image: url(../img/bg_mid.gif);
	background-repeat: repeat-y;
	height: 400px;
}
.content_main_company {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 1050px;
}
.content_main_faq {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 600px;
}

.content_main_core {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 1100px;
}

.content_main_full {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 1750px;
}

.content_main_dvd {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 1200px;
}

.content_main_web {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 900px;
}

.content_main_privacy {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 750px;
}

.content_main_houhou {
	width: 1050px;
	background-image: url(../img/bg_mid150.gif);
	background-repeat: repeat-y;
	height: 1050px;
}

